Abstract

The invention discloses a power grid topology analysis method based on Gaussian elimination algorithm. The power grid topology analysis method comprises the following steps: applying a Gaussian elimination technology to topological structure analysis, and carrying out edge weight taking on plant-station topological structures to form incidence matrixes thereof; for all plant-station topological structures, and recording the dependence mapping relationship of electric nodes, logic nodes and system nodes according to the changes of node number accumulative pointers so as to form incidence matrixes between system nodes and impedance elements; carrying out incidence matrix elimination, topological matrix front substitution and back substitution operation on the incidence matrixes of the plant-station topological structures and the incidence matrixes of system network architectures, and carrying out analysis of the corresponding topological structures; and according to the analysis result,determining the quantity of electric power system sub-systems and the equivalent calculation model of each sub-system. The power grid topology analysis method has the advantages of high speed and reliability, online function of plant-station topology, power grid topology and local topology can be realized, the calculation speed is high, and the method is applicable for the requirements such as real-time state estimation and online load flow calculation.

technical field [0001] The invention relates to a network topology analysis method based on a Gaussian elimination algorithm. Background technique [0002] Topological analysis is based on the status of components, such as the open and closed status of switches and switches, the operation and shutdown status of equipment, and the analysis of the connectivity of the transmission network, thus forming an equivalent analysis model. [0003] Traditional power system topology analysis methods generally express the topology structure as a linked list relationship, and use depth-first or breadth-first search algorithms to analyze the connectivity of nodes. This topology analysis method has poor performance and cannot satisfy real-time topology functions. Contents of the invention [0004] In order to solve the above problems, the present invention proposes a network topology analysis method based on Gaussian elimination algorithm.
